Quick Facts
  • Daughter of Dan and Karen O’Hara
  • Has one brother, Jerry, and one sister, Erin

  • Father, Dan, is a former fighter pilot in the U.S. Navy and brother, Jerry, is also a Navy pilot

  • A lifelong forward, switched to the left back position during the 2012 Olympic qualifying tournament and went on to play every minute at outside back for Team USA during the 2012 Olympic Games

  • Selected third overall by FC Gold Pride in the 2010 WPS Draft

  • Won the 2009 Hermann Trophy as the top collegiate soccer player in the country

  • Interests include surfing and baking, with her mother, Karen, providing all her baking recipes

  • Host of the Just Women’s Sports podcast where her goal is to generate “open, candid conversations” about the lives of athletes, particularly female athletes”

Olympic Experience
  • 2012: Gold Medal
  • 2020: Bronze Medal
World Championships Experience
  • Most recent: 2019 – gold
  • Years of Participation: 2011, 2015, 2019
  • Medals: 3 (2 golds, 1 silver)
